Kepler-62e (also known by its Kepler Object of Interest designation KOI-701.03) is a super-Earth exoplanet (extrasolar planet) discovered orbiting within the habitable zone of Kepler-62, the second outermost of five such planets discovered by NASA's Kepler spacecraft. | Subject | Predicate | Object | Confidence | Src |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Kepler-62e | Detection method | Transit (Kepler Mission) | 1.00 | infobox |
| Kepler-62e | Discovered by | Borucki et al. | 1.00 | infobox |
| Kepler-62e | Discovery date | 18 April 2013 | 1.00 | infobox |
| Kepler-62e | Discovery site | Kepler Space Observatory | 1.00 | infobox |
| Kepler-62e | Eccentricity | ~0 | 1.00 | infobox |
| Kepler-62e | Inclination | 89.98 ± 0.032 | 1.00 | infobox |
| Kepler-62e | Mass | 4.5+14.2 −2.6 M🜨 | 1.00 | infobox |
| Kepler-62e | Mean radius | 1.61 ± 0.05 R🜨 | 1.00 | infobox |
| Kepler-62e | Orbital period (sidereal) | 122.3874 ± 0.0008 d | 1.00 | infobox |
| Kepler-62e | Semi-major axis | 0.427 ± 0.004 AU | 1.00 | infobox |
| Kepler-62e | Star | Kepler-62 (KOI-701) | 1.00 | infobox |
| Kepler-62e | Temperature | Teq: 270 K (−3 °C; 26 °F) | 1.00 | infobox |
